by runningchoc » Sat Oct 30, 2010 4:08 pm
I would do it. Charles has scored more points than Marshall this season so far and he's still playing "second fiddle". The Chiefs running game is perhaps the best in the league and Charles has been remarkably consistent so far with double digits in 4 games. Marshall has had 2 big games and has otherwise been a liability week to week in fantasy. You'd move Moss into your starting WR spot and Charles would essentially replace Marshall in your lineup as a flex. This to me is an easy decision. Especially since Charles role can't go anywhere but up.
